博客 基于深度学习的自主智能体实现方法

基于深度学习的自主智能体实现方法

   数栈君   发表于 2025-09-23 14:45  48  0

基于深度学习的自主智能体实现方法

在数字化转型的浪潮中,企业正在寻求更高效、更智能的方式来优化运营、提升决策能力和增强用户体验。基于深度学习的自主智能体(Autonomous Agent)作为一种新兴的技术,正在成为实现这些目标的关键工具。本文将深入探讨基于深度学习的自主智能体的实现方法,为企业和个人提供实用的指导和见解。


一、什么是自主智能体?

自主智能体是一种能够在动态环境中感知、推理、决策并采取行动以实现特定目标的实体。与传统的基于规则的系统不同,自主智能体能够通过学习和经验不断优化其行为,适应复杂多变的环境。基于深度学习的自主智能体利用神经网络的强大能力,从大量数据中学习模式和规律,从而实现自主决策和行动。

核心要素:

  1. 感知能力:通过传感器、摄像头或其他数据源获取环境信息。
  2. 决策能力:基于感知信息,利用深度学习模型进行推理和决策。
  3. 行动能力:根据决策结果执行动作,如控制机器人、调整参数或与用户交互。

二、基于深度学习的自主智能体实现方法

实现一个基于深度学习的自主智能体需要经过多个步骤,包括数据采集、模型设计、训练与优化、部署与测试等。以下是具体的实现方法:

1. 感知与数据处理

自主智能体的第一步是感知环境。这需要通过传感器、摄像头或其他数据采集设备获取实时数据。对于深度学习模型来说,数据的质量和多样性至关重要。

  • 数据采集:根据应用场景选择合适的传感器。例如,在智能制造中,可能需要使用摄像头进行视觉检测;在智慧城市中,可能需要使用温度、湿度等环境传感器。
  • 数据预处理:对采集到的数据进行清洗、归一化和特征提取,以提高模型的训练效率和准确性。
  • 数据增强:通过数据增强技术(如旋转、缩放、噪声添加等)扩展数据集,帮助模型更好地泛化。
2. 决策与行动

自主智能体的核心在于决策能力。基于深度学习的模型需要能够根据感知信息做出最优决策,并通过行动影响环境。

  • 模型设计:选择适合任务的深度学习模型。例如,卷积神经网络(CNN)适用于图像处理任务,循环神经网络(RNN)适用于时间序列预测任务。
  • 决策机制:设计决策逻辑,例如基于强化学习的策略网络或基于监督学习的分类模型。
  • 行动执行:根据决策结果执行相应的动作。例如,控制机器人移动、调整生产线参数或与用户进行自然语言交互。
3. 学习与优化

深度学习模型需要通过大量的数据进行训练,并通过反馈机制不断优化其性能。

  • 监督学习:通过标注数据训练模型,使其能够识别模式和规律。
  • 强化学习:通过与环境交互,利用奖励机制优化模型的决策能力。
  • 在线学习:在实际运行中持续更新模型参数,以适应环境的变化。

三、基于深度学习的自主智能体关键技术

1. 强化学习(Reinforcement Learning)

强化学习是一种通过试错机制优化决策能力的技术。自主智能体通过与环境交互,获得奖励或惩罚,并根据这些反馈调整其行为策略。

  • 应用场景:适用于需要动态决策的任务,如游戏AI、机器人控制和自动驾驶。
  • 实现方法:设计状态空间、动作空间和奖励函数,训练策略网络以最大化累计奖励。
2. 注意力机制(Attention Mechanism)

注意力机制是一种帮助模型关注重要信息的技术,特别适用于处理序列数据或多源信息。

  • 应用场景:在自然语言处理、图像识别等领域,注意力机制可以帮助模型聚焦于关键部分。
  • 实现方法:通过计算查询(Query)、键(Key)和值(Value)的相似性,生成注意力权重并加权求和。
3. 多智能体协作(Multi-Agent Collaboration)

在复杂的环境中,单个智能体往往无法完成所有任务,需要多个智能体协同工作。

  • 应用场景:如无人机编队、智能交通系统和多人在线游戏。
  • 实现方法:设计通信协议和协作策略,使多个智能体能够共享信息并协调行动。
4. 边缘计算(Edge Computing)

为了实现低延迟和高实时性,自主智能体的计算任务可以部署在边缘设备上。

  • 应用场景:如自动驾驶汽车、工业机器人和智能安防系统。
  • 实现方法:通过边缘计算技术,将模型部署在靠近数据源的设备上,减少数据传输延迟。

四、基于深度学习的自主智能体的应用案例

1. 智能制造

在智能制造中,自主智能体可以用于质量检测、设备维护和生产优化。

  • 质量检测:通过计算机视觉技术,自主智能体可以实时检测产品缺陷。
  • 设备维护:通过预测性维护算法,自主智能体可以提前发现设备故障并进行维修。
  • 生产优化:通过优化算法,自主智能体可以调整生产线参数,提高生产效率。
2. 智慧城市

在智慧城市中,自主智能体可以用于交通管理、环境监测和公共安全。

  • 交通管理:通过实时数据分析,自主智能体可以优化交通信号灯控制,减少拥堵。
  • 环境监测:通过传感器网络,自主智能体可以监测空气质量、温度和湿度等环境指标。
  • 公共安全:通过视频监控和行为分析,自主智能体可以实时识别异常行为并发出警报。
3. 游戏与娱乐

在游戏和娱乐领域,自主智能体可以用于游戏AI、虚拟助手和虚拟现实。

  • 游戏AI:通过强化学习,自主智能体可以训练出具有人类水平的对手或队友。
  • 虚拟助手:通过自然语言处理技术,自主智能体可以与用户进行智能交互。
  • 虚拟现实:通过自主智能体技术,可以实现更逼真的虚拟场景和角色行为。
4. 数字孪生

数字孪生是一种通过虚拟模型反映物理世界的技术,自主智能体可以用于数字孪生的模拟和优化。

  • 模拟预测:通过数字孪生模型,自主智能体可以模拟物理世界的运行状态并预测未来趋势。
  • 优化决策:通过自主智能体的决策能力,可以优化数字孪生模型的运行参数,提高效率。

五、基于深度学习的自主智能体的挑战与未来方向

1. 挑战
  • 数据质量:深度学习模型对数据质量要求较高,需要大量标注数据进行训练。
  • 计算资源:深度学习模型的训练和推理需要大量的计算资源,可能对企业造成成本压力。
  • 安全性:自主智能体的决策可能受到攻击或干扰,需要考虑安全性问题。
  • 伦理问题:自主智能体的决策可能涉及伦理问题,如自动驾驶汽车在紧急情况下的选择。
2. 未来方向
  • 更高效的算法:开发更高效的深度学习算法,降低计算资源消耗。
  • 多模态感知:结合多种感知方式(如视觉、听觉、触觉)提高自主智能体的感知能力。
  • 人机协作:研究人与自主智能体之间的协作方式,使其更符合人类需求。
  • 可持续发展:关注自主智能体的能源消耗和环境影响,推动绿色技术发展。

六、申请试用&https://www.dtstack.com/?src=bbs

如果您对基于深度学习的自主智能体感兴趣,或者希望了解更多关于数据中台、数字孪生和数字可视化的解决方案,可以申请试用相关产品或服务。通过实践和探索,您将能够更好地理解这些技术的实际应用和潜在价值。


通过本文的介绍,您应该对基于深度学习的自主智能体的实现方法有了更深入的了解。无论是企业还是个人,都可以通过学习和实践,掌握这一前沿技术,为未来的数字化转型做好准备。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料